Phoenix
Phoenix is the capital, largest city, and largest metropolitan area of the state of Arizona, United States. As of the 2000 census, Phoenix ranked: the sixth largest city of the United States, with a population of 1,321,045; the fourteenth largest metropolitan area of the United States, with a population of 3,251,876; and the largest capital city in the United States (including Washington, DC). Phoenix is the county seat of Maricopa County. It was incorporated on February 5, 1881. Phoenix is the principal city of the Phoenix metropolitan area. Phoenix is served by several major television stations, among them are: KTVK-3 (News Channel 3, Independent) , KPHO-5 (CBS 5, CBS), KAET-8 (Channel 8, PBS), KSAZ-10 (FOX 10, FOX), KPNX-12 (Channel 12, NBC), KNXV-15 (ABC 15, ABC), KUTP-45 (UPN 45, UPN), KASW-61 (WB 61, WB). There are also many radio stations to listen to in Phoenix. The city has two main traditional newspapers: The Arizona Republic serves the greater metropolitan area and East Valley Tribune tends to focus on East Valley issues. In addition, the city is also served by numerous free neighborhood papers and weeklies such as the Phoenix New Times, Arizona State University's State Press, and the College Times. The sports teams located in Phoenix are: Arizona Diamondbacks, Major League Baseball; Arizona Cardinals, National Football League; Phoenix Suns, National Basketball Association; Phoenix Mercury, Women's National Basketball Association; Phoenix Coyotes, National Hockey League (team plays in Glendale); Arizona Rattlers, Arena Football League; Arizona Thunder, indoor soccer ; Arizona Sting, National Lacrosse League. The sporting venues present in Phoenix are: Phoenix International Raceway, Indy Racing League and NASCAR; Manzanita Speedway, sprint car racing; Firebird International Raceway, boat racing, drag racing, road course. The following tournaments are also an annual feature in Phoenix: Phoenix Open, PGA TOUR; Standard Register Turquoise Classic, LPGA; Tradition, PGA Champions Tour; Fiesta Bowl at Arizona State University's Sun Devil Stadium.
